🏛️ Synnada-Prymnessus
Greco-Roman settlement in Phrygia, central Anatolia


🕐 2 min read · Updated 14 Mar 2026 at 18:46
📌 Fast Facts
  • Location: Near modern Şuhut, Afyonkarahisar Province, Türkiye
  • Period: Hellenistic through Byzantine eras, roughly 3rd century BCE–7th century CE
  • Known for: Marble quarries and production; administrative centre under Roman rule
  • Status: Archaeological site with scattered ruins; no formal visitor infrastructure

Synnada-Prymnessus was a significant settlement in ancient Phrygia, situated at the intersection of trade routes in central Anatolia ...
